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?

Wat je nodig hebt

Video overzicht

  1.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?,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 1, afbeelding 1 van 1
    • Je schroef is doorgedraaid en je schroevendraaier is niet meer in staat de schroef alsnog te verwijderen. Voordat je zwaar geschut uit de kast haalt, kun je alvast het volgende proberen:

    • Gebruik verschillende schroevendraaiers. Probeer eerst schroevendraaiers met een ietwat kleinere of grotere kop. Probeer vervolgens een platkopschroevendraaier om te zien of je grip kunt krijgen op in ieder geval een deel van de doorgedraaide schroef.

    • Als het bitje geen grip weet te krijgen op de schroefkop, ga dan ook niet verder. Als je wel verder gaat, loop je het risico de schroefkop nog verder te beschadigen.

    • Als een van deze technieken blijkt te werken: gefeliciteerd! Je hebt je schroef alsnog weten te verwijderen.

  2.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 2, afbeelding 1 van 3 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 2, afbeelding 2 van 3 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 2, afbeelding 3 van 3
    • Je kunt een rubberen band of elastiek gebruiken om de extra grip te krijgen die je nodig hebt.

    • Trek een rubberen band over de doorgedraaide schroef heen.

    • Steek een schroevendraaier met het juiste formaat in de schroefkop en probeer deze, nu het rubber voor extra grip zorgt, los te draaien.

  3.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 3, afbeelding 1 van 2 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 3, afbeelding 2 van 2
    • Als de schroefkop nog steeds toegankelijk is, kun je proberen een schroefverwijdertang te gebruiken. Als je een goede grip op de schroefkop weet te krijgen, kun je de tang draaien en zou de schroef mee moeten draaien!

    • Als de schroef eenmaal een klein beetje losgedraaid is, kun je deze waarschijnlijk verder los draaien met behulp van een schroevendraaier.

  4.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 4, afbeelding 1 van 3 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 4, afbeelding 2 van 3 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 4, afbeelding 3 van 3
    • Zit je schroef nog steeds vast? De volgende methode vraagt dat je de kop van je schroevendraaier op de schroefkop vastlijmt met behulp van secondelijm.

    • Breng eerst de secondelijm aan op de schroefkop.

    • Druk de kop van je schroevendraaier in de schroefkop en laat de secondelijm een tijdje drogen.

    • Probeer je schroevendraaier, als de lijm gedroogd is, met een stevige druk naar beneden en een goede grip nog een keer te draaien om de schroef te verwijderen.

    • Vergeet niet de lijmresten van de kop van je schroevendraaier te verwijderen na deze stap.

    Also might suggest applying the tiny ammount of super glue to the tool tip not the screw. If you accidently squeeze out too much the overflow can be cleaned off the tool and the glue reapplied much easier than it can be removed from the screw and the surrounding areas of the device. Alternately the surrounding areas can be masked from excess glue with a bit of transparent tape.

  5.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 5, afbeelding 1 van 1
    • Als je de schroef niet hebt weten te verwijderen met de voorgenoemde methoden (verschillende schroevendraaiers, een tang, een rubberen elastiek en secondelijm) kun je het nog eens proberen met een dremel.

    • Bevestig een dunne slijpschijf op je dremel. Zorg dat je deze schijf, voordat je begint met slijpen, goed hebt bevestigd.

    • Zorg dat je bij het gebruik van je dremel te allen tijde oogbescherming draagt om fysieke schade als gevolg van rondvliegende vonken en scherven te voorkomen.

  6.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 6, afbeelding 1 van 2 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 6, afbeelding 2 van 2
    • In deze stap zul je je dremel gebruiken om een kleine snede in de schroefkop van de doorgedraaide schroef te slijpen. Dit geeft je de mogelijkheid om een platkopschroevendraaier in de schroefkop te plaatsen en je schroef te verwijderen.

    • We raden je aan om je dremel op een van de laagste standen te zetten qua kracht (wij hebben standje 2 van de 6 gebruikt) om te voorkomen dat je de rest van het toestel of van de schroef per ongeluk beschadigt.

    • Je wilt dat je snede diep genoeg is voor de platkopschroevendraaier om grip te krijgen en te behouden, maar je wilt dat deze snede ook dun genoeg is zodat de platkopschroevendraaier precies in de snede past.

    • Maak een enkele, dunne snede in de kop van de doorgedraaide schroef.

  7. Hoe verwijder je een doorgedraaide schroef?: stap 7, afbeelding 1 van 1
    • Gebruik tot slot een platkopschroevendraaier om de schroef uit je toestel te verwijderen.

    • De grootte van de schroevendraaier hangt af van de grootte van de schroef, maar gebruik altijd de grootste schroevendraaier die in de snede past.

    • Als geen van je schroevendraaiers in de snede past, gebruik je je dremel nog eens om de snede te vergroten. Maak enkel kleine snedes; als je namelijk te veel van de schroefkop afslijpt, zul je geen goede grip kunnen krijgen met je schroevendraaier en zul je de schroef alsnog niet kunnen verwijderen.

    • Draag te allen tijde oogbescherming en blaas je toestel even goed schoon voordat je deze weer in elkaar gaat zetten. De dremel kan heel wat metaalscherven voortbrengen en in het toestel verspreiden, wat tot kortsluiting kan leiden als je dit niet goed schoonmaakt.

    One technique that wasn't covered here but has worked wonders for me is to use a small dab of hot glue and hold the bit in it until hardened. The hot glue grabs any small imperfections and of course forms perfectly around the bit. A drop of oil in the treads helps too for tough cases. It works for basically any type of screw (even one you don't have quite the right size bit for). The downside is it's a bit tedious to do if there are many damaged screws. Yet one more idea that might work is a trick I sometimes use on larger seized fasteners on cars. Using a very sharply pointed punch (like a sturdy nail which has been sharpened) and a small hammer, make an indentation in the screws head out close to the edge (hold the punch vertical for first few taps) then tilt the punch about 45 degrees and while keeping the point in the indentation tap in the correct direction to unscrew the fastener. Repeated impacts will unscrew the fastener.
